Transaction 3ee870284155b0ff99ea791f6a9a15daab49bb419986a2d23e6b78590f5f8efd
1 Input
1 Output
-
3ee870284155b0ff99ea791f6a9a15daab49bb419986a2d23e6b78590f5f8efd:0
- value
- 366533796
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c6d4d392139f31015dc2f3338b83ac0c2b06631c OP_EQUAL
- address
- 3KpLfy3Fr4k2oMNgBGjD2hE7gk27sBNTvL